On January 10, 2025, Tesla launched a redesigned version of the Model Y in China, with deliveries set to begin in March. The new Model Y features a full width light bar as its headlight and taillight, as well as a touchscreen for passengers in the rear seat. The long-range version also has an extended range of 719 kilometers (447 mi), up from the previous 688 kilometers (428 mi). As customers of other Models complained about the lack of the turn signal stalk, the 2025 Model Y refresh keeps traditional turn signal stalk.
On January 23, 2025, Tesla revealed that its updated Model Y SUV will be available in the U.S., Canada, and Mexico starting in March, with a starting price of approximately US$60,000. This "Launch Series" special edition includes a 320-mile range battery and Tesla’s advanced driver-assistance technology, “Full Self-Driving (Supervised),” which is typically a $8,000 upgrade. In comparison, the older Model Y begins at $44,990 with a 337-mile range for its rear-wheel drive variant.
